Railway Evaluation


EnTech provides subsurface diagnostics that offer a dynamic view of subsurface conditions that can affect railway infrastructure. Our stacking technologies create a comprehensive system that supplies our clients with timely and accurate information enabling them to make informed decisions.

Railway evaluation begins with an Infrared Energy Pattern Analysis (IR-EPA) investigation at the client-specified areas. Our IR-EPA systems detect specific temperature patterns created by underground voids, pipeline leaks, abandoned foundations and underground storage tanks (USTs).

The IR-EPA investigation can be complimented with Light Detection and Ranging (LIDAR) for large aerial surveys. Sub-meter GPS accuracy ensures that field crews can easily locate each anomalous area. We can investigate the entire system without disrupting workflow and cut costs because of our abilities to target the areas which need further investigation.

Each investigation can be futher explored utilizing Second Generation Ground Penetrating Microwave Radar (GPR). GPR provides 3-D views of specific areas that require more detail than IR-EPA can provide. This additional information, such as composition, depth, and size of underground anomalies, can help our clients remediate underground leaks.

Project

A large Southern water municipality called EnTech for assistance when a section of distribution pipelines running under several sets of railroad tracks was believed to be leaking, causing erosion and voids. The objective was to identify and locate the leaks without disrupting the pipelines or rail traffic.

Our Technology

Our Professional engineers used Infrared Energy Pattern Analysis (IR-EPA) sensing equipment to identify the pipeline and their leaks, and Second Generation Ground Penetrating Microwave Radar (GPR) to provide 3-D analysis including depth and density of each anomaly. By blending these technologies with expert analysis, we produced an all-inclusive report that enabled our client to quickly find and remediate each anomalous area.
